Ohio State announced a lucrative jersey patch agreement with the banking institution JPMorganChase on Tuesday.
The record-setting deal is worth a reported $17 million per year and includes patches for all 36 Buckeyes teams.
Ohio State athletic director Ross Bjork said in a news release that the partnership includes branding at stadiums and 'enhances the Buckeyes' overall competitive success and facilitates academic partnerships across the university.'
'JPMorganChase is a global brand with deep roots in Ohio, making them a natural partner that shares our commitment to innovation, excellence and long-term community impact,' Bjork said. 'Together, we have built a comprehensive and historic partnership that reflects the strong commercial strength of the Ohio State Athletics identity and the broader college athletics landscape.'
Ohio State did not confirm the value of the pact. Multiple outlets reported that in addition to putting its logo on the school's jerseys, the deal with Chase includes NIL opportunities for the Buckeyes' student-athletes.
Ohio State is the fourth Big Ten school to announce a jersey patch deal following Illinois (Busey Bank), Michigan State (MSUFCU) and Wisconsin (Culver's). The Illinois-Busey Bank deal is worth a reported $6 million annually, according to Front Office Sports.
